## Artifact Signing — Bucketwise Assignment Service

Quick recap for the sync: every Bucketwise build now gets signed before it can hit the experiment-assignment fleet. The CI step runs right after unit tests, so unsigned artifacts just won't promote — no more manual overrides like we had during the Falloway incident. Marta added a verification hook to the deploy gate too, so staging and prod check the same chain. For local testing, sign with the key below.

signing key of bagap-yawep = bky13_TbfT6ZMUoGJo2

Context: Quillon's user-profile store was recently split into 16 shards keyed by account ID. Profiles created before the migration use 12-char legacy IDs and hash inconsistently.

Repro:
1. Pick any legacy-ID profile from the fixtures bundle.
2. Run the rebalance script against shard set B.
3. Fetch the profile via the admin API — returns 404, though the row exists on shard 3.

Expected: lookup resolves regardless of ID format. The admin API requires authentication, so use the service token provided below.

session JWT of tadup-kaguf = eyJhbGciOiJIUzI1NiIsInR5cCI6IkpXVCJ9.eyJzdWIiOiItNz4V3In0.KrZCeqpk

Test plan for the Mossbrook monthly-partition rollout: we'll verify that inserts route to the correct month partition, that the midnight boundary doesn't double-write, and that dropping a stale partition doesn't lock readers. If you're on call during the run, watch the partition-maintenance job logs. To query the maintenance API directly, authenticate with the bearer token provided below.

portal login ticket: eyJhbGciOiJIUzI1NiIsInR5cCI6IkpXVCJ9.eyJzdWIiOiIwEOsktwVNwIn0.-UJU3fdyyCgG

☐ Verify clock skew across all Brindlewood build agents before the Quorum Forge key ceremony begins. Agents drifting more than 250 ms from the ceremony coordinator's reference clock must be resynced and re-attested, since signature timestamps outside the tolerance window invalidate the transcript. Record skew readings in the ceremony log and have the second reviewer countersign. If the transcript vault must be reopened mid-ceremony, use the passphrase below.

recovery phrase for fawif-tajeg: norael-aldmir-casir-brivan-ulaion